i was driving my truck tonight and it ran fine until the gass pedal had very little response and it was basically idle and lots of white smoke coming out the exhaust i have no idea any input would be appreciated
you have an injector sticking and when then engine cools a little at idle its not burning all of the fuel . when you start driving again the temps go up and the fuel is burned so it not as visible unless you are at an idle . the egr has an effect on this problem , but will not stop it . will help clear it up . you can try pulling it out and cleaning it off . if there is alot of carbon on it it sticks and will be stuck in the middle of open and closed .
